When one of the rear wheels is off the ground, the transmission
alone will not prevent the vehicle from moving or slipping off the
jack, even if the transmission is in P (Park). To prevent the vehicle
from moving when you change the tire, be sure that the parking brake
is set and the diagonally opposite wheel is blocked. If the vehicle slips
off the jack, someone could be seriously injured.

Stowing the spare tire
1. Lay the tire on the ground, near the rear of the vehicle, with the valve
stem side facing up.
2. Install the retainer through the
wheel center.
3. Using the jack handle and winch
extension tools, turn the jack handle
clockwise until the tire winch
“overrides.”
Note:The wrench will become
harder to turn until the winch
“overrides.”You will hear a
clicking sound from the winch
when the tire is properly stowed.
The wrench will then become
easier to turn. The winch handle
ratchets (clicks) when the tire is
raised to the stowed position. It
will not allow you to overtighten.
4. Remove the tools from the winch and reinstall the access plug.
Disassemble the tools and snap them back into the tool tray. Reinstall
the tray into the vehicle and secure it with the wing nut by turning the
wing nut until tight.
JUMP STARTING YOUR VEHICLE
The gases around the battery can explode if exposed to flames,
sparks, or lit cigarettes. An explosion could result in injury or
vehicle damage.
Batteries contain sulfuric acid which can burn skin, eyes, and
clothing, if contacted.
Do not attempt to push-start your vehicle. Automatic
transmissions do not have push-start capability; also, the
catalytic converter may become damaged.

Preparing your vehicle
When the battery is disconnected or a new battery is installed, the
transmission must relearn its shift strategy. As a result, the transmission
may have firm and/or soft shifts. This operation is considered normal and
will not affect function or durability of the transmission. Over time, the
adaptive learning process will fully update transmission operation.
1.Use only a 12–volt supply to start your vehicle.
2. Do not disconnect the battery of the disabled vehicle as this could
damage the vehicle’s electrical system.
3. Park the booster vehicle close to the hood of the disabled vehicle
making sure the two vehiclesdo nottouch. Set the parking brake on
both vehicles and stay clear of the engine cooling fan and other moving
parts.
4. Check all battery terminals and remove any excessive corrosion before
you attach the battery cables. Ensure that vent caps are tight and level.
5. Turn the heater fan on in both vehicles to protect any electrical
surges. Turn all other accessories off.
